Responsibilities

  • Maintain complete case visibility — every active case has a documented current stage, next action, assigned owner, and deadline at all times.
  • Enforce structured task assignment — no task floats without an owner and a due date.
  • Protect court deadlines — zero missed deadlines, period. At least 80% of court-related tasks are completed 3+ business days before the filing date.
  • Ensure weekly client communication — 100% of active clients receive proactive weekly updates, logged and documented.
  • Report accountability patterns to leadership — weekly visibility reports identifying overdue tasks, bottleneck patterns, deadline compression, and case stagnation.
